Sikander Malik paced restlessly in the dimly lit room, his sharp footsteps echoing off the concrete walls. The tension in the air was palpable, charged with the anger of a father scorned. His men stood before him, fear etched into their faces as they delivered the news: Meerab and Murtasim had evaded capture. Their failure gnawed at Sikander, a wound that deepened with every passing second.

“How could you let them slip through your fingers?” Sikander barked, his voice a low growl. His men shifted uncomfortably, exchanging wary glances. They knew their boss was ruthless, but the stakes were even higher now that his precious daughter was involved. This was personal.

“Sir, we tracked them to the safe house, but they were gone by the time we arrived. They must have had help,” one of the men stammered, his voice trembling under the weight of Sikander's fury.

“Help?” Sikander’s voice rose, shaking with rage. “You let my daughter run away with a mere bodyguard, and you call that help?” He halted abruptly, his hands balled into fists at his sides, his knuckles white with suppressed anger.

Zain, Meerab’s fiancé, stood silently beside Sikander, his jaw clenched in frustration. Chosen by Sikander himself, Zain was seething at the humiliation of his fiancé running off with another man, especially someone like Murtasim. The feeling of betrayal coursed through him like poison, darkening his thoughts.

“Once we catch them, I’ll kill them both painfully,” Zain said, his voice dripping with venom. His eyes sparkled with rage as he imagined the ways he could exact his revenge.

Sikander’s hand shot out, striking Zain across the face with a resounding crack that echoed in the small room. “Don’t you dare speak about my daughter like that!” Sikander thundered, his eyes blazing. “She is my heir, the future owner of my business. She will take over the Malik empire, and you must remember your place.”

Zain stood there, stunned by the blow, but inside, he seethed with anger and humiliation. How dare Sikander defend her? Zain had always lusted after Meerab, seeing her as a trophy to elevate his own status within the Malik hierarchy. Now, with Murtasim in the picture, his plans were unraveling, and he was determined to reclaim what he believed was rightfully his.

Sikander’s expression shifted slightly, the anger in his eyes giving way to a cold determination. “My daughter is innocent in all this,” he said, his voice low and menacing. “Murtasim is the one who manipulated her. He took advantage of her vulnerability and led her astray. Otherwise, she would never have done such a thing.”

Zain felt a surge of indignation at the mention of Murtasim’s name, the bodyguard who had dared to disrupt his plans. “You can’t seriously believe that, Sikander. She ran away with him! There’s no way she’ll come back to you now.”

Sikander’s gaze hardened. “I will bring her back, Zain. Once I do, I will ensure that Murtasim suffers for what he has done. His death will be a mercy compared to the punishment I have in store for him. Mark my words, Meerab will marry you, and you will have the power you crave.”

Zain swallowed his anger and forced himself to nod, hiding the tumultuous emotions roiling within him. “Yes, but I need to know when. This cannot stand. I want her back and Murtasim dead.”

Sikander turned, his face a mask of fury mixed with paternal protectiveness. “I will not rest until I have my daughter back. I’ll give Murtasim a chance to suffer the consequences of his actions. He has made a grave mistake, one that will cost him dearly.”

Zain’s heart raced with a mix of anticipation and desperation. He needed Meerab back, not just for the power she represented but also to regain his lost pride. “I will help you,” he said, his voice low and dangerous. “I’ll do whatever it takes to find them.”

Sikander nodded, the anger still simmering beneath the surface. “We will track them down, Zain. I won’t let my daughter be lost to some fleeting whim. Murtasim thinks he’s clever, but he has no idea who he’s dealing with.”

The two men exchanged a knowing glance, a dark alliance forged in the fire of their shared resentment. The game had changed; the stakes were personal now. They would not rest until Meerab was back in Sikander’s grasp and Murtasim paid the price for his audacity.

As Sikander’s men moved quickly to gather intelligence and resources, Zain felt a rush of adrenaline course through him. He would not allow himself to be sidelined in this narrative; he would ensure his place at the head of the Malik empire, no matter the cost.

With a newfound resolve, he stepped closer to Sikander, ready to plot their next move. “Let’s make them pay for their betrayal,” he said, a sinister smile creeping across his face.

Sikander returned the smile, a dangerous glint in his eyes. “Yes, we will show them what happens when they defy the Maliks.”

The air was thick with tension, anticipation buzzing in the room as they began to devise a plan, knowing that soon, the chase would begin in earnest. They would bring Meerab back, and when they did, Murtasim would wish he had never crossed paths with her.
